Setting netmask on Solaris 10 sparc?



Greetings. I just installed our 1st Solaris 10 system, and am finding it
to be substantially different than Solaris 9 - or else I'm just losing
my mind!

I've configured an interface (hme0) in /etc/hostname.hme0, and set the
netmask in /etc/inet/netmasks and modified /etc/hosts,
/etc/defaultrouter, /etc/resolv.conf, /etc/nodename.

On reboot, the interface is right, default route is right, but netmask
is not what I set it to be and thus DNS doesn't work, etc. The netmask
may be what it was set to when I was building the system. There has to
be a hidden file somewhere that is changing this. Can some kind soul
please point me in the right direction? Thanks much!
